Precautions for applying plaster:

1. If you accidentally cause muscle contusion or joint or ligament strain during exercise or work, do not immediately apply pain-relieving ointment or musk-chasing ointment to the injured area. Because this type of plaster has the effect of promoting blood circulation and removing blood stasis, applying it immediately after an injury cannot achieve the purpose of reducing swelling and relieving pain.

2. If there is local damage, do not apply the plaster directly to the damaged area to avoid suppurative infection.

3. Pregnant women should not use plasters containing blood-activating and blood-stasis-removing ingredients such as musk, frankincense, safflower, myrrh, peach kernel, etc.

4. If papules or blisters appear on the local skin after applying the plaster, and you feel severe itching, it means you are allergic to the plaster. You should stop applying it immediately and receive anti-allergic treatment.

5. Do not apply the plaster if you are allergic. If you feel itching, burning or stinging on the applied skin about 10 minutes after applying the plaster, remove it immediately. This indicates that the patient is allergic to the plaster. People with allergies are usually not suitable for applying plasters because their skin is prone to rashes. Applying plasters will not only hinder the absorption of the medicine, but will also cause skin problems.

6. No more than 24 hours. Since the plaster is used on the skin surface, the plaster usually contains drugs with strong odors. It is applied to the body surface to stimulate nerve endings, dilate blood vessels through reflexes, promote local blood circulation, improve nutrition of surrounding tissues, and achieve the purpose of reducing swelling, inflammation and analgesia. Generally, a dose of plaster should not be used for more than 24 hours. If it is used for too long, not only will the medicine lose its effectiveness, but it will also be bad for the skin.
